Continue ReadingThese are the early morning standouts that really jumped out at you with their play at The Great Western Classic.
6’5 SF Blake Rawson || American Fork High School || 2024 ||
Blake is a hybrid type of player that can get down in the post and get to work but he can also step out and pass the ball to open players. Really impressed with his vision and willingness to pass the ball. AF has reloaded as they will be one of the top teams in 6A.
6’6 W Kallen Lewis Kallen Lewis 6'6" | CG Corner Canyon | 2023 State UT || Corner Canyon High School || 2023 ||
This kid is agile and a true wing on a team that is looking for player to make a difference with a lot of open spots on the roster. Kallen rebounds well and plays hard. He has a nice looking shot and he will be the 4th option but he is going to have games were he goes off on the glass and in the points column. Look for him to make a name for himself this year as a player that just does the dirty work and hits open looks.
6’0 PG Yorgio Golesis Yorgio Golesis 5'10" | SG Skyline | 2023 State UT || Skyline high School || 2023 ||
Athletic ability was on full display this morning as he was that rotation guy getting some weakside block shots. He also got out on the break and through one down as well. He is very good when he is moving around keeping the defense on their toes. This then allows him to catch the ball on the move and he is tough to stop on the move. Moving forward if he is the lead guard or off the ball he is dangerous if used the right way.
6’0 PG Ace Reiser Ace Reiser 6'0" | PG Alta | 2024 State UT || Bingham High School || 2024 ||
Just a crafty guard that was getting really nasty with the ball as teams switched their big in him and he was just mixing kids. Good shot and driving ability is nice, but he distributed too many times when he had an opportunity to take over. Although he made the right play and read you can see that he will likely take over soon.
6’9 F Abraham Oyeadier || Balboa Prep (CA) || 2024 ||
Abraham was imposing and although he was met with another big that often made him miss shots you can see the raw talent as he rebounds and has a great motor on both ends of the floor. Interesting raw talent with some raw skill.
6’6 CG Isiah Harwell || JM Elite || 2025 ||
Isiah is guest playing with JM Elite and he is killing it. His mid-range pull-up jumper is very elite and he is handling the ball better as a lead guard. He is active on the defensive glass which then allows him to get out on the break and find players or it gives him the ability to drive and kick. When you watch this kid play he just passes that eyeball test. Does a little bit of everything and he does not shy away from anything or anyone.
